move various bits into .init.* sections
authorJan Beulich <jbeulich@novell.com>
Wed, 9 Mar 2011 16:31:00 +0000 (16:31 +0000)
committerJan Beulich <jbeulich@novell.com>
Wed, 9 Mar 2011 16:31:00 +0000 (16:31 +0000)
commitcba76631d1fc7b511facfca6449a0c1d5565fbf0
tree566b375a761c58618a3cdb4e6e6d970c9760a735
parent007f425ac5d2bc0b607fb4fb429ad92315f52de1
move various bits into .init.* sections

This also includes the removal of some entirely unused functions.

The patch builds upon the makefile adjustments done in the earlier
sent patch titled "move more kernel decompression bits to .init.*
sections".

Signed-off-by: Jan Beulich <jbeulich@novell.com>
31 files changed:
xen/arch/ia64/xen/hpsimserial.c
xen/arch/ia64/xen/xensetup.c
xen/arch/x86/Makefile
xen/arch/x86/acpi/cpufreq/powernow.c
xen/arch/x86/apic.c
xen/arch/x86/cpu/mcheck/Makefile
xen/arch/x86/dmi_scan.c
xen/arch/x86/irq.c
xen/arch/x86/mm/mem_sharing.c
xen/arch/x86/numa.c
xen/arch/x86/setup.c
xen/arch/x86/tboot.c
xen/arch/x86/time.c
xen/crypto/rijndael.c
xen/crypto/vmac.c
xen/drivers/char/serial.c
xen/drivers/cpufreq/cpufreq.c
xen/drivers/cpufreq/cpufreq_misc_governors.c
xen/drivers/cpufreq/cpufreq_ondemand.c
xen/drivers/passthrough/pci.c
xen/drivers/passthrough/vtd/dmar.c
xen/drivers/passthrough/vtd/dmar.h
xen/drivers/passthrough/vtd/ia64/vtd.c
xen/drivers/passthrough/vtd/x86/vtd.c
xen/include/acpi/cpufreq/cpufreq.h
xen/include/asm-x86/apic.h
xen/include/asm-x86/mach-default/mach_mpparse.h
xen/include/asm-x86/mach-summit/mach_mpparse.h
xen/include/crypto/vmac.h
xen/include/xen/dmi.h
xen/include/xen/serial.h